1. Understanding Pet Lifecycles in The Sims 4
The Sims 4 Cats & Dogs expansion pack brought with it the joy of adding furry friends to your Sims’ families. These pets, whether cats or dogs, go through different life stages, just like Sims. Understanding these stages is key to deciding when and why you might want to age up your pet. From playful puppies and kittens to wise old companions, each stage offers unique interactions and challenges.
- Kitten/Puppy: The initial stage, full of playful antics and learning.
- Adult: The prime of their life, where they are most active and trainable.
- Elder: A slower pace, with more naps and a need for gentle care.

2. The Age Up Treat: A Simple Solution
Dog receiving a treat in Sims 4, suggesting aging up
One of the simplest ways to age up your pet is by using the Age Up treat. This treat can be purchased from the vending machine at any vet clinic for 150 Simoleons. If you’re feeling crafty, you can also make the treat yourself, provided your Sim has the necessary skills and ingredients. The Age Up treat provides a safe and easy way to advance your pet to the next life stage, ensuring they develop and experience new adventures within the game. It is ideal for players who enjoy a balanced approach to pet care, as it offers a direct method without disrupting the game’s natural progression.
2.1. Purchasing the Age Up Treat
To purchase an Age Up treat, simply take your Sim and their pet to the nearest vet clinic. Interact with the vending machine, and you’ll find the Age Up treat available for purchase.

3. Using Cheat Codes to Age Up Pets Instantly
For players who want instant results, cheat codes offer a quick and easy way to age up pets. Cheat codes allow players to bypass the usual gameplay mechanics and instantly alter their pet’s life stage, saving time and resources. Here’s how to do it:
3.1. Enabling Cheats
First, you need to open the cheat console by pressing ‘Ctrl+Shift+C’ on your keyboard. Type ‘testingcheats true’ and press Enter. You should see a message that says, ‘cheats are enabled.’ This step is crucial for unlocking the full potential of cheat codes in The Sims 4, allowing you to manipulate various aspects of the game to your liking.
3.2. Using the CAS Full Edit Mode Cheat
Next, type ‘cas.fulleditmode’ and press Enter. This cheat unlocks all the options in Create-A-Sim (CAS) mode, allowing you to make changes to your pet’s appearance and age. This is a powerful tool that gives you complete control over your pet’s development and customization.
3.3. Modifying Your Pet in CAS
Select your pet and choose ‘modify in CAS.’ Once in CAS mode, you can change your pet’s age to any stage you desire. This immediate transformation allows you to quickly see your pet in different phases of their life.

4. Reversing Age and Halting the Aging Process
Sometimes, you might want to reverse your pet’s age or stop them from aging altogether. Luckily, The Sims 4 provides options for both. Halting or reversing the aging process gives you greater flexibility in managing your pet’s life, allowing you to customize your gameplay experience to your preferences.
4.1. Age Down Treats
Like the Age Up treat, you can purchase Age Down treats at the vet clinic. These treats will revert your pet to a younger life stage. Age Down treats offer a balanced approach to managing your pet’s life, providing a direct method without disrupting the game’s natural progression.
4.2. Disabling Auto Age
To halt the aging process, go to the ‘Gameplay’ tab in the game options and disable ‘Auto Age.’ This will stop your pet from aging naturally, allowing you to keep them in their current life stage indefinitely. Disabling Auto Age offers a long-term solution, allowing you to maintain your pet’s current state without constant intervention.
